This is the sixth version of a patch series that implements the GSoC
microproject of converting a recursive call to readdir() to use dir_iterator.

Back in v5, Michael had a number of suggestions, all of which were applied
to this version (including a slightly modified version of his "biggish rewrite"
project to make dir_iterator's state machine simpler). The only suggestion that
did not make it into this series was that of not traversing into subdirectories,
since I believe it would be better off in another series that actually required
that feature (that is, I do not want a series to implement a feature it will
not need). The same goes for Junio's thought on a flag to list *only* directories
and no files on the v4 discussion.

Junio and Peff's comments about how to write to files in the tests were also
considered, and the tests were adjusted.

I chose to squash both the state machine refactor and the addition of the
new flags in a single commit. I do not know whether you will feel this is
the right choice but it seemed natural, since most of the state machine's
new logic would not even make sense without encompassing the new features.
I am, of course, open for feedback on this decision.
